Xiaomi Mi Pad

Indulge in the 7.9-inch wonderland of multimedia and gaming with the Xiaomi Mi Pad. Driven by a formidable Quad-core 2.2 GHz Cortex-A15 Nvidia Tegra K1 processor, with a GeForce Kepler (192 cores) GPU, 2 GB RAM, and 16 GB expandable storage, it's a multimedia machine. Seize this outstanding deal at just 10,999 INR (a 2000 INR saving) on the Flipkart app!

HP Laptop Quad Core A8

Power on with the HP 15-af024AU APU Quad Core A8 laptop. Priced just 23,990 INR on Flipkart, it features a 2.2 GHz AMD Quad core A8 processor, 4 GB RAM, a spacious 1 TB HDD, and a 15.6-inch LED backlit HD display. Outfit your tech life with Windows 8.1 from the get-go.
